Output 859cd0774bcfc6ea8a951f26d7761dac5bfe52c7768bddc17bcd81c4681001ea:1

value
397343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b5b96c28d7f2494599c19423e0255d7aa248b0e OP_EQUAL
address
3Qc5FQGR7kVS7wgXEnZuiyPBESioRRa5d7
transaction
859cd0774bcfc6ea8a951f26d7761dac5bfe52c7768bddc17bcd81c4681001ea
confirmations
308761
spent
true